
III CD With Autographed Booklet
Bad Books first new album in seven years, III, will be released on June 21st via Loma Vista Recordings. A first glimpse of the album has also arrived through two new songs, each illustrating the strength of the two songwriting halves that form Bad Books’ stunning whole: the gorgeous, heart-rending slow burn of Andy Hull’s “Lake House” and the bewitching, melancholic lilt of Kevin Devine’s “I Love You, I’m Sorry, Please Help Me, Thank You”. III ushers in a new era of the band featuring principal members Hull and Robert McDowell, both of Manchester Orchestra, and Devine.
